Introduction

RetroApollo, a 22-year-old 6-feet tall man, shared his weight loss journey on Reddit. During the 4-month journey, he managed to lose 30lbs and reach his goal of 200lbs. His post gained attention and encouragement from fellow Redditors on the Fitness thread.

Strategy and Tips

RetroApollo shared his strategies that included intermittent fasting, a calorie deficit diet, and weight lifting. He also changed his workout routine every 4-6 weeks to avoid plateauing. In addition, he learned to balance his meals, count his calories with apps like MyFitnessPal, and track his progress with pictures and measurements.
